Built to Last: The Unmatched Durability of TimberTouch Putters
At TimberTouch Putterworks, we believe performance should never come at the expense of longevity. That’s why our putters are built from some of the hardest exotic hardwoods available—materials that often exceed twice the hardness of traditional woods like walnut or oak. This dense structure provides a resilient surface that resists dents, dings, and wear far beyond what most putters can withstand.
